Leading health expert, award-winning author, and radio show host, Nancy Addison discusses nutrition, supplements, antibacterial essential oils, soaps, and oxygen. Nancy talks about the COVID-19 situation, health, masks, social distancing, medical intervention, and the state of the world today. Nancy expands on ways to approach life, make changes, and handle with emotional situations.
